FACILITIES TICKET — Priority: Low
Location: Basement Archive Room, Harwick House
Raised by: Reception rota lead

Archive room B-04 door latch sticks after the damp issue last month. Until the joiner visits, reception staff may need to let couriers in manually for file retrievals. Push the door firmly at the top corner while turning the handle. Log every entry in the blue ledger on the shelf. Use the code below to open the keypad lock.

turnstile pass: bdg-QZV-3

While reviewing alert history for the Lanternfall reporting database, I found the replica-lag alarm on the secondary in the Osmere region firing far less often than expected. The deployed threshold is 120 seconds, but the approved runbook value is 30 seconds; someone apparently raised it during an incident in March and never reverted it. This masks genuine staleness in the reporting tier. Please review the attached change restoring the agreed values. The alarm should be redeployed with the following configuration:

service settings:
quenath:
  log_level: info
  metrics_host: metrics.quenath.tolvaqlabs.internal
  pin: 1407
  pool_size: 8

Subject: Queue-depth autoscaler cut-over complete

Hi Mara,

The cut-over from the legacy CPU-based scaler to the new queue-depth autoscaler on Ferroline finished at 02:10 with no dropped jobs. We ran both scalers in shadow mode for an hour first and confirmed the new one tracked backlog correctly. Rollback steps remain documented in the runbook, though we don't expect to need them. For your records, the autoscaler is now running with the following configuration values.

settings of kawig-kahip:
ULAETH_PIN=4988
ULAETH_TENANT=briath
ULAETH_METRICS_HOST=metrics.ulaeth.xolmarworks.test
ULAETH_SEAL=seal_e1a2fe42
ULAETH_STANDBY_TEAM=pelix

**Q: Are the lifts running this weekend?** No. Both lifts in the Halloway Annexe are down for winch maintenance Saturday 06:00 to Sunday 18:00. Direct staff to the east stairwell. Goods deliveries should be deferred or rerouted via the Penfold loading dock. Contractors from Bray Vertical Systems will be on site; they sign in at the facilities desk as normal. The stairwell door locks after 19:00, so anyone working late will need the weekend access code. Issue it only to rostered staff. The code is below.

badge for bawef-bahap: bdg-LALUM-4